總結:This study aims to test a theoretical model formed, i.e., whether symbolic playing is influenced by age, gender, and socio-economic background of the childrenâ��s parents (parental income) and the ability to understand mental state of the self and otherâ��s mental state. Furthermore it is to test whether the age have influence on theory of mind (ToM). The subjects of this study were 51 children consisting of boys and girls aged 36- 84 months with a various backgrounds of socio-economic status. The data collection was observation of the playing process through a running record conducted by 4 raters. Reliability and Inter-rater reliability coefficients were 0.913. The Symbolic and imaginary play used were tools which had been test by 7 professional judgments, i.e., kindergarten teachers and preschool teachers. Content Validity Index (CVI) of observation instruments of symbolic and imaginary play was 0.351 and CVI of theory of mind instrument was 0.323. Data on age, gender and socioeconomic status were obtained through the identity data of the children. The data analysis was performed using variance-based SEM method, i.e., Partial Least Square (PLS). The evaluation of overall model showed that all the variables or constructs had appropriateness between constructed model and empirical model. ToM and age significantly influenced the symbolic and imaginary play. Whereas gender and parental income had no significant effect to the symbolic and imaginary play. ToM and age had no significant relationship. The ToMâ��s influence degree to the symbolic and imaginary play was in the high category, whereas the influence of age to the symbolic and imaginary play was in the medium category.
